    Advances in Quantitative Analysis of Multicomponent Tobacco Flavors

    • An overview of the research progress of quantitative analysis methods of the complex tobacco flavors was presented. The common chromatographic quantitative analysis methods, like area normalization method, internal standard method, external standard method and standard addition method, were mainly used to quantify the targeted compounds in the tobacco flavors. The profound and thorough quantitative analysis of all components of the tobacco flavors could be achieved by the multi-standard method, characterized peak-internal standard method and multivariate calibration method (48 ref. cited).
